    Oh Noni I soooo hear you... in my first pregnancy I just craved deep fried food ALL THE TIME.

    My suggestion is think about what exactly you're craving, then get it a healthier way, eg if you're craving crunchy saltiness, then try some pretzels or popcorn, if you're craving chocolatty flavour, have a hot chocolate (with real milk) or a small chocolate custard...kwim?

    The one thing that always undoes me is when I go on an MSG bender - omg I can't get enough of the stuff - it's in all those yummy things like cheezels and doritos and packet macaroni cheese. Only way I found to get off the MSG is just to go cold turkey. Which prolly isn't what you want to hear LOL.
